Title

Reference files of Albinia de la Mare: 'Lecture drafts and notes, bibliographies, notes on manuscripts (B[ritish] L[ibrary], Pisa, et al.'

Shelfmark

MS. 18746/191

Summary

Comprises:

Folder 1: papers, mainly relating to codicology, 1974-1998 and n.d. [c.1990-1997], including

bibliographies for 'Codicology', 'Description of texts', 'Layout and Decoration', 'Paper and Binding', 'Handwriting in Western Europe', 'The Medieval Manuscript Book - VI, Humanists, History of the Book MA', and 'Italian Humanistic Manuscripts'

folding examples

photocopies of manuscripts, and other materials specifically intended for teaching

Folder 2: 'Lectures', lecture notes and drafts and related papers, 1987-1999 and n.d. [c.1990-1997], including

'The Scriptorium of Malatesta Novello' (1 p., incomplete)

'Codicology of Italian Humanistic Manuscripts', King's College lecture II, 25 Jan 1989 (4 pp., in particular analysing Derolez, Codicologie)

'La produzione del libro umanistico', Zurich, Centro di Studi Italiani, 18 Nov 1997

papers relating to a lecture in Cremona, 1992 (text, 7 pp.)

lecture notes relating to the most important centres and regions of Italian humanistic manuscript production, mainly connected with lectures at New York, Columbia University, Rare Book School, 1987; Padua, 1987; Cremona, 1992; and Pisa, 1998-1999

images of manuscripts for lectures, and for a query regarding Paris, Bibliothèque nationale de France, Lat. 6179

Folder 3: correspondence and papers, 1986-1997, relating to

a lecture for the Autenrieth colloquium, Munich, including notes on manuscripts to consult at Munich, Bayerische Staatsbibliothek, 1986-1987

'Vespasiano da Bisticci as producer of classical manuscripts in 15th century Florence', a paper given at a conference in Leiden in Jul 1993 and published in C.A. Chavannes-Mazel and M.M. Smith eds., Medieval Manuscripts of the Latin Classics: Production and Use. Proceedings of the Seminar in the History of the Book to 1500, Leiden 1993 (Los Altos Hills, California, 1996), 1993-1996

lectures at the Seminar in the History of the Book to 1500, Tilly-Fest', St. Cross Building, Oxford, 21-22 Jun 1997

Folder 4: notes and lecture text, 1995-1999 and n.d. [c.1995-1999], relating to

'R & W on Petrarch'

London, British Library, Royal 15 C. XV; Add. 11987 (Seneca, Tragedies, Mussato, signed by Salutati); Harl. 1705 (Plato, translated by Decembrio); 5248 (Augustine, De musica, scribe Giovanni Aretino); 5285 (Plautus, Sozomeno); Royal 5 F. II (translations by Beccaria)

Pisa, Biblioteca Cathariniana, MS. 37; 27; 59; 11; 124; 177; 189; 46; 136; 125; 176; 4; 2; 188; 180

Pisa, Biblioteca Universitaria, MS. 542; 544; 723; 691; 532 (Milan?, third quarter 15th century?); 531 (Bartolomeo Sanvito); 537 (Rome, 1461?); 536; 535; 12 (Matteo Palmieri, De bello italico); 540 (Aurelius Victor, Boccaccio, Florence or Tuscan); 529 (Isocrates, Seneca, Napoli, third quarter 15th century); 532

Brussels, Bibliothèque Royale, MS. 4031-4033

'Description of a manuscript', for Pisa, 1998-1999

'manuscripts to see', Vienna, Österreichische Nationalbibliothek, Cod. 184; 3; 206; 37; and Cologny-Genève, Bibliotheca Bodmeriana, MS. lat. 130

'Jane's notes (?deriv[ed] from Julian [Brown?]) on history of the quire'

'Teaching notes, codicology'

Folder 5: 'Xeroxes used for Padua [lecture]', 1987

Date

1974-1999 and n.d. [c.1990-1999]

Language

English

Physical extent

1 box (5 folders)
